Tudawal
Tudawal is a village located in Nizamabad tehsil of Azamgarh district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Nizamabad (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Azamgarh. As per 2009 stats, Tudawal village is also a gram panchayat.

About Tudawal
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tudawal is 194306. The village spans a total geographical area of 69.87 hectares. Nizamabad is nearest town to Tudawal village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Tudawal
According to the 2011 Census, Tudawal has a total population of about 808, with approximately 371 males and 437 females. The sex ratio is around 1177 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 127 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 108 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 62.50%, with male literacy at about 73.85% and female literacy near 52.86%. There are around 123 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 808 | 371 | 437 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 127 | 64 | 63 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 108 | 47 | 61 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 505 | 274 | 231 |
Illiterate Population | 303 | 97 | 206 |
Connectivity of Tudawal
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tudawal. As per the 2011 stats, Tudawal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
